Output 57bda0385e40770654a9433a6ebffec4543b4127167f85c988c58c8ec5b7df62:2

value
474432609
script pubkey
OP_0 OP_PUSHBYTES_20 55cf9d7e8c0de87997c05c5ab130823d1bfe3252
address
bc1q2h8e6l5vph58n97qt3dtzvyz85dluvjj369yfx
transaction
57bda0385e40770654a9433a6ebffec4543b4127167f85c988c58c8ec5b7df62
spent
true